Lauren Bacall in "The Fan" as Part of Spring Film Series at Southampton CollegeSeries Sponsored by Dan's Papers is Free and Open to the Public

- Southampton College will present Lauren Bacall in "The Fan" as part of a series of films made on or about Long Island. The series, entitled "The Dan's Papers They Made the Movie Here Film Festival," is co-sponsored by Dan's Papers and is free and open to the public.
The film will be shown on Saturday, May 4 at 2:30 p.m. in Duke Lecture Hall at Southampton College of Long Island University.
Film and stage legend Lauren Bacall stars in her most controversial role as a famous Broadway star who becomes the unwilling love object of a psychotic fan. James Garner stars as her ex-husband and Maureen Stapleton as her secretary.
The series continues on Saturday, May 11 with Ed Burns' "She's The One" and will conclude with the great cinema verite documentary "Grey Gardens" by Albert and David Maysles on May 25.
